S and S Excavation and Hauling started with a forestry mulcher and a simple idea: do the hard work yourself, do it right, and earn every dollar. Based out of Manchester, Tennessee, the company was founded by a veteran who brought military discipline to the dirt work industry. No office managers, no sales teams, no runaround. When you call S and S Excavation, the person who answers is the same person who shows up to your property with the equipment.
The business began with forestry mulching — clearing overgrown land, removing brush, and transforming neglected properties into usable ground. That first mulcher was the foundation. Over time, as clients kept asking for more, the operation expanded into full excavation, grading, site preparation, demolition, and hauling. But the core never changed: one owner, one crew, one standard of work.
Growing up in Middle Tennessee, the owner understood the land — the rocky clay soil of Coffee County, the rolling terrain of Bedford and Franklin Counties, the challenges of building on Tennessee hillsides. That local knowledge combined with veteran-trained work ethic created something different from the typical excavation contractor. No shortcuts. No excuses. Just results you can see from the road.
Today, S and S Excavation and Hauling serves a 200-mile radius from Manchester, covering eight counties and more than thirty cities across Middle Tennessee. The company operates a fleet of excavators, mulchers, skid steers, and hauling trucks — all maintained to military standards. Every project, from a residential lot clearing to a commercial site development, gets the same level of attention and discipline.

Our Journey
Forestry Mulching Roots
Started with a single forestry mulcher clearing overgrown properties in Coffee County. The work was simple but demanding — transforming dense brush into clean, usable land one acre at a time. Word spread through Manchester and surrounding communities.
Expanding Into Full Excavation
As clients requested more than mulching, S and S added excavation equipment. Digging foundations, trenching utilities, grading lots — the company expanded from land clearing into comprehensive site work. The first excavator changed the scope of what was possible.
Serving Eight Counties
The service area expanded from Coffee County to cover Bedford, Franklin, Warren, Cannon, Rutherford, Grundy, and Moore Counties. The 200-mile radius from Manchester meant more projects, more challenges, and more trust from property owners across Middle Tennessee.
Full-Service Site Work
Today S and S Excavation and Hauling offers 13 services — from forestry mulching and bush hogging to commercial excavation, demolition, paving, and site development. The same veteran discipline that started this company drives every project. Over a decade of experience. Thousands of acres cleared, graded, and prepared across Tennessee.
